How to bring response rate calculation into "Matrix"

I've got a Matrix table like below with "Count of EDM Segments" sent and "Count of Donation Value" (which is the response back), how do I bring the "Response rate%" into this Matrix?  Which will be Response rate % = "Count of Donation Value"/"Count of EDM Segments"

 

Power bi test.PNG

 

I've created a "New Measure":

Syria EDM Responses % = (count('Syria Children''s Emergency Appeal'[Donation Value]))/(count('EDM-Syria Children''s Emergency Appeal Aug 2016'[EDM Segments]))

 

But when i bring this into "Matrix" or "KPI", it says below.

HI IVYHAI

 

IT SEEMS TO ME THAT YOUR DATA TYPE IS WRONG. YOU NEED TO SELECT DECIMAL NUMBER DATA TYPE TO NAIL THIS ISSUE.
